摘要:

ABSTRACTAn investigation of eleven types of insulating brick was made. Physical properties determined included bulk density, porosity, transverse and crushing strength, pyrometric cone equivalent, volume shrinkage at 2300°F, 2500°F, and 2700°F, load deformation at elevated temperatures, and resistance to spalling.
